Brothers and Teachers: Conversations on Identity, Growth, and Connection
Curious about the journeys that shape our true selves? 'Brothers and Teachers' is a podcast that brings you into heartfelt conversations about identity, addiction, depression, adventure, intuition, love, relationships, and much more. Hosted by Bowen Dwelle, this series features people who embody a positive presence and strive to be their most authentic selves. It's a celebration of those who teach us through their actions and words, highlighting individuals making a difference in the world.
Each episode dives into the complexities of human experience, from the struggles of addiction to the joys of self-discovery. Guests from diverse backgrounds share their stories with raw honesty, discussing everything from toxic masculinity to the transformative power of physical activity. They explore how vulnerability can lead to profound personal growth and stronger connections with others.
Whether it's through writing, spiritual growth, or embracing one's true identity, 'Brothers and Teachers' offers listeners a chance to reflect on their own journeys and find inspiration in the stories of others. With guests like Ashanti Branch, Kim Stanley Robinson, and Dr. Adi Jaffe, this podcast provides a rich tapestry of insights that encourage empathy and understanding.
